org.sonar.commons.rules
Class RuleFailureParam

java.lang.Object
  extended by org.sonar.commons.BaseIdentifiable
      extended by org.sonar.commons.rules.RuleFailureParam

public class RuleFailureParam
extends BaseIdentifiable


Field Summary
static int PARAM_KEY_COLUMN_SIZE
           
protected  java.lang.Integer snapshotId
           
 
Constructor Summary
RuleFailureParam()
           
RuleFailureParam(java.lang.String key, java.lang.Double value, java.lang.Double value2)
           
 
Method Summary
 java.lang.String getKey()
           
 RuleFailure getRuleFailure()
           
 java.lang.Double getValue()
           
 java.lang.Double getValue2()
           
 void setKey(java.lang.String key)
           
 void setRuleFailure(RuleFailure ruleFailure)
           
 void setSnapshot(Snapshot snapshot)
           
 void setValue(java.lang.Double value)
           
 void setValue2(java.lang.Double value2)
           
 
Methods inherited from class org.sonar.commons.BaseIdentifiable
getId, setId
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

PARAM_KEY_COLUMN_SIZE

public static final int PARAM_KEY_COLUMN_SIZE
See Also:
Constant Field Values

snapshotId

protected java.lang.Integer snapshotId
Constructor Detail

RuleFailureParam

public RuleFailureParam(java.lang.String key,
                        java.lang.Double value,
                        java.lang.Double value2)

RuleFailureParam

public RuleFailureParam()
Method Detail

setSnapshot

public void setSnapshot(Snapshot snapshot)

getRuleFailure

public RuleFailure getRuleFailure()

setRuleFailure

public void setRuleFailure(RuleFailure ruleFailure)

getKey

public java.lang.String getKey()

setKey

public final void setKey(java.lang.String key)

getValue

public java.lang.Double getValue()

setValue

public void setValue(java.lang.Double value)

getValue2

public java.lang.Double getValue2()

setValue2

public void setValue2(java.lang.Double value2)


Copyright © 2009 SonarSource SA. All Rights Reserved.